What a difference a few days can make. When the Lightning visited the Coliseum on Tuesday, they came in winners of 6-of-10 and we’re looking like the team we all thought they could be. After four straight losses in which the team looked listless, including Tuesday night, the Bolts are reeling. In their last game on Wednesday, they took a 3-0 lead into the third in Pittsburgh and wound up losing 4-3 in overtime. That’s the game Evgeni Malkin reportedly offered up $1,000 to his teammates if they made a third period comeback. I’m not entirely sure Malkin even needed to do that, as he was involved in three of the Pens’ four goals. With the loss, the Lightning have now lost four in a row but are still eight points up on the Islanders in the Tavares/Hedman sweepstakes.
As for the Islanders, they’ve played well of late but haven’t gotten off to good starts. In each of their last two games, they’ve come out sluggish in the first period, getting out shot a combined 21-13 during the opening frame. On the flip side, they’re actually out shooting their opponents 39-35 over the final two periods.
In today’s game, look for Yann Danis to get the start in goal. Coach Gordon has said that he would start each goalie on the team’s two-game Florida road trip and if that thinking hasn’t changed, Danis would start tonight.

Injury notes: Isles’ official site reports that Nate Thompson was placed on injured reserve yesterday and Sean Bergenheim has been activated. Greg Logan reports that Bergenheim will be on the fourth line along with Richard Park and Tim Jackman. Mark Streit practiced today but will not suit up for the game.
